IP | 51.77.128.156:25800 |
---|---|
Players | 1 / 10 |
Region | Europe |
Country |
![]() |
Map | Liyuwoki County |
Date Created | 2025-08-21 20:01:18 |
Date Updated | 2025-08-23 06:01:20 |
Rent Server |
Unknown Players | 1 |